Everyone has his or her own opinion about what is worth reading.
I only have three on-line comic links and Schlock Mercenary is one of them ( Girl Genius and Buck Godot are the other two )

I like it because the story line is original and often funny and always (mostly always) clever. If I can't wait for tomorrow because I NEED to know what happens next, it's worthy of my time. I like it enough that I spent the cold hard cash on hard copies of the books. Besides, who doesn't find a heavily armed sentient pile of poop funny?

So, go to the Archives link, pick a series ( Try Book 3: Under New Management if you are turned off by starter graphics but want to get a taste of the strip) and read through till you decide if you like it. If you do, buy some stuff to support Mr. Taylor (or just read it and move on you cheap bastard). If you don't, no harm, no foul, it's just not your cup of tea.
